2 Collard Place is a 137 m² / 1,475 sq ft terraced home in Chalk Farm. It sold for £1,585,000 in November 2018.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£1,545k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£1,285k to £1,939k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 1 June 2026.

- The most recent sale price indexed forward to today's value is £1,544,773. This is one data point to inform the valuation. Another method is the valuation implied by what comparable homes are selling for. Homes in Chalk Farm are now selling for between £9,380 and £14,150 per square metre (£871 and £1,314 per square foot). Based on an internal area of 137 m², this implies a valuation between £1,285,000 and £1,939,000. Treat this as context only.
